How much do remote investment performance analyst j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 2,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ote investment performance analyst in Chicago, IL is $77,455.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$56,700.00 and $92,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Remote Investment Performance Analyst vs Remote Investment Analyst?

AspectRemote Investment Performance AnalystRemote Investment Analyst
CertificationsChartered Financial Analyst (CFA), CFA Level I/II/IIIChartered Financial Analyst (CFA), CFA Level I/II/III
Work EnvironmentRemote, financial firms, asset management companiesRemote, financial firms, asset management companies
Primary FocusAnalyzing investment performance metrics, reportingResearching investments, portfolio analysis
Common UsagePerformance measurement, reporting rolesInvestment research, asset analysis roles

The main difference is that the Remote Investment Performance Analyst specializes in evaluating and reporting on investment performance metrics, while the Remote Investment Analyst focuses more broadly on researching and analyzing investment opportunities. Both roles often require similar certifications and work in similar environments, but their core responsibilities differ in focus and daily tasks.

Job description

About Turing:
Based in San Francisco, California, Turing is the world’s leading research accelerator for frontier AI labs and a trusted partner for global enterprises deploying advanced AI systems. Turing supports customers in two ways: first, by accelerating frontier research with high-quality data, advanced training pipelines, plus top AI researchers who specialize in coding, reasoning, STEM, multilinguality, multimodality, and agents; and second, by applying that expertise to help enterprises transform AI from proof of concept into proprietary intelligence with systems that perform reliably, deliver measurable impact, and drive lasting results on the P&L.

Role Overview:
Turing is looking for Research analysts to work with our researchers to improve the performance of AI models. You will apply your expertise in equity research, sector analysis, financial modeling, and investment thesis development to evaluate and train AI systems. If you enjoy solving complex problems in financial research and are interested in shaping the future of AI in finance, please apply. No prior AI experience is required.

What Does Day-to-Day Look Like:
  • Evaluate LLM models on research topics such as equity valuation, sector analysis, earnings estimate modeling, and investment thesis formulation.
  • Create rubrics to assess model capabilities on tasks like DCF modeling, comparable company analysis, industry research, and initiating coverage reports.
  • Collaborate with AI researchers and fellow finance experts to shape training methods, evaluation strategies, and benchmarks.

Requirements:
  • 2+ years of experience in Equity Research, Credit Research, or Sell-Side/Buy-Side Research.
  • Strong grasp of financial statement analysis, valuation methodologies, sector dynamics, and investment recommendation frameworks.
  • Excellent English written communication.

Bonuses (Not at All Necessary):
  • CFA (Level I/II/III) or MBA in Finance.
  • Perks of Freelancing with Turing:
    • Work on the cutting edge of AI and finance.
    • Fully remote ad flexible work environment.
  • Competitive hourly compensation of ~$100+/hour depending on experience.

Offer Details:
  • Commitment: Flexible, 10–30 hrs/week.
  • Duration: ~1 month, with the possibility of extension based on performance and project needs.
